位置:百问excel教程网 > 资讯中心 > excel问答 > 文章详情

不同excel如何核对

作者:百问excel教程网
|
128人看过
发布时间:2026-03-15 15:28:36
当您需要对比两份或多份来源不同或版本更新的电子表格数据时,核心需求是精准、高效地找出差异。要解决不同excel如何核对的难题,关键在于根据数据量、结构复杂度以及您的具体目标,选择合适的手动筛选、公式匹配、条件格式标注或专业工具比对等方法,系统性地进行数据验证与修正。
不同excel如何核对

       不同excel如何核对?

       在日常工作中,我们常常会遇到这样的困扰:手头有几份来自不同部门、不同时期或不同系统的Excel表格,它们可能都记录了相似的信息,比如客户名单、销售数据或库存清单。乍一看似乎一样,但仔细对比,又总担心其中存在细微的出入。这时,一个根本性的问题就摆在了面前:不同excel如何核对?面对这个需求,很多人会感到无从下手,要么靠肉眼逐行检查,效率低下且容易出错;要么简单地将数据复制粘贴在一起,却无法清晰定位差异。实际上,核对不同Excel文件是一项需要策略和技巧的任务,其核心目标不仅仅是发现不同,更是要高效、准确、可追溯地识别并处理这些差异。

       明确核对目标与数据状态

       在开始任何技术操作之前,首先要厘清核对的目的。您是想找出两份表格中完全相同的记录,还是只存在于其中一份的独特项?是关注特定几列数值的变动,还是需要整体结构的对比?同时,必须评估数据本身的状态。表格的结构是否一致?即列标题、列顺序是否完全相同?数据量有多大?是几百行还是几十万行?数据是否相对规整,是否存在大量合并单元格、空白行或格式不一致的情况?明确这些前提,是选择后续核对方法的基石。

       基础手动法:排序与筛选

       对于结构简单、数据量较小的表格,最直接的方法是手动比对。您可以先将两个工作表的关键列(如订单编号、员工工号)分别按照相同规则进行升序排序。然后,将两个表格并排显示在屏幕上,通过滚动浏览进行目视对比。利用Excel的筛选功能也能辅助查找差异。例如,您可以在一份表格中筛选出某个条件的数据,然后到另一份表格中查看对应记录是否存在或数值是否匹配。这种方法直观,无需复杂操作,但严重依赖人的注意力,效率低且不适合大数据量或复杂对比。

       公式比对法:利用函数精准定位

       当数据量上升到数百上千行时,公式是强大而精准的武器。最常用的函数是VLOOKUP(查找函数)或它的升级版XLOOKUP(如果您的Excel版本支持)。基本思路是:在一个表格(我们称为表A)旁边插入辅助列,使用VLOOKUP函数去另一个表格(表B)中查找匹配项。如果找到则返回您需要比对的数值,如果找不到则返回错误值。通过判断返回结果与表A原值是否相等,或者是否出现错误值,就能快速标记出差异项或独有项。例如,公式“=VLOOKUP(A2, 表B!$A:$D, 4, FALSE)”可以在表B的A到D列中查找与A2单元格匹配的值,并返回第4列的数据。

       条件格式法:让差异一目了然

       如果您希望差异点能够自动、醒目地标注出来,条件格式是绝佳选择。您可以将两个需要对比的区域分别设置条件格式规则。例如,选中表A的数据区域,点击“条件格式”->“新建规则”->“使用公式确定要设置格式的单元格”,输入类似“=A1<>Sheet2!A1”的公式(假设Sheet2是另一个表格的对应位置),并设置一个突出的填充色。这样,只要表A的单元格与表B对应位置的单元格内容不同,该单元格就会被自动高亮。这种方法非常适合并排列出的、结构完全相同的两个数据块的快速视觉对比。

       高级公式组合:应对多条件复杂核对

       现实中的核对需求往往更复杂。比如,需要同时依据两列或三列信息(如“日期”+“产品代码”)作为匹配键来核对第三列(如“销量”)。这时,可以组合使用函数。一种常见的方法是使用SUMIFS(多条件求和函数)或COUNTIFS(多条件计数函数)。通过COUNTIFS函数在另一个表格中计数匹配关键组合的记录数量,如果结果为0,则说明该组合在另一表中不存在。也可以使用“&”符号将多个条件列合并成一个辅助键,再对这个单一的键进行VLOOKUP查找,从而简化问题。

       使用“查询”功能进行表间合并

       对于经常需要整合和核对多表数据的用户,Excel内置的Power Query(在数据选项卡下可能显示为“获取和转换数据”)是一个革命性的工具。您可以将不同的Excel表格或工作表作为数据源导入Power Query编辑器中。然后,使用“合并查询”功能,这类似于数据库中的连接操作。您可以选择一种连接类型(如左外部、完全外部、内部),并指定匹配的列。合并后,系统会生成一个新表,其中可以同时包含两个源表的所有列,并清晰显示出匹配成功和匹配失败的记录,差异一目了然。此方法尤其适合数据源需要定期刷新的情况。

       借助“数据透视表”进行汇总对比

       当您的核对目标是比较汇总数据而非明细行时,数据透视表是理想工具。您可以分别基于两个表格创建数据透视表,将需要统计的字段拖入“值”区域进行求和、计数等计算。然后将两个透视表的汇总结果放在一起对比。更高级的用法是,利用Power Query将多个表格合并整理成一个规范的数据模型后,再创建数据透视表。在这个透视表中,您可以将“数据源”作为筛选字段,通过切换来对比不同来源的汇总数据,或者将不同来源的同一度量值并列显示,差异瞬间呈现。

       第三方插件与专业比对工具

       如果您的核对工作极其频繁,或者处理的是极其庞大、复杂的表格,寻求专业工具的帮助是明智之举。市面上存在一些优秀的Excel第三方插件,它们通常提供了直观的“表格比较”功能,只需选择两个工作表或工作簿,点击按钮,工具就会自动生成一份详细的差异报告,列出所有新增、删除、修改的内容,甚至能高亮显示单元格级别的变化。此外,也有一些独立的文件对比软件,它们不仅能对比Excel,还能对比文本、代码等,功能更为强大。这类工具将您从繁琐的公式设置中解放出来,极大提升了核对效率和准确性。

       核对过程中的关键注意事项

       无论采用哪种方法,一些共通的注意事项必须牢记。第一,备份原始数据。在进行任何合并、修改操作前,务必保存好原始文件的副本,以防操作失误导致数据丢失。第二,注意数据类型。有时看起来相同的数字,可能一个是数值型,另一个是文本型,这会导致公式匹配失败。使用“分列”功能或VALUE函数、TEXT函数进行统一转换。第三,警惕隐藏字符和空格。单元格内容开头或结尾的空格、不可见的换行符等,都会影响精确匹配。可以使用TRIM函数和CLEAN函数进行清理。

       构建标准化的核对流程

       对于团队协作或周期性任务,建立一套标准化的核对流程至关重要。这包括:定义清晰的数据模板,确保所有参与方提交的表格结构统一;制定明确的核对规则文档,说明使用何种方法、对比哪些关键字段、差异如何处理;设计固定的核对报告模板,将差异结果以规范化的格式呈现。流程化不仅能减少沟通成本,还能确保每次核对结果的一致性和可靠性,将个人经验转化为团队资产。

       处理核对出的差异结果

       找出差异只是第一步,如何处理这些差异才是最终目的。对于识别出的“独有数据”,需要追溯其来源,判断是应该补充到主表中,还是属于无效或过期数据应予以剔除。对于数值上的“不一致”,则需要与相关责任人确认,以确定哪个数据源是正确的,并据此更新错误的一方。所有差异的处理决定和修正操作,都应该有记录可循,这既是数据质量管理的要求,也为未来的审计或复盘提供了依据。

       从核对延伸到数据治理

       频繁地需要核对不同Excel,本身可能反映出一个更深层次的问题:数据管理缺乏统一的入口和规范。因此,当核对成为常态工作时,就应该思考如何从源头减少这种需求。这可能意味着需要推动建立统一的数据库、使用协同办公平台中的单一数据源、或者部署专业的企业报表系统。将分散的Excel表格整合进更健壮的数据管理体系中,是从根本上提升数据一致性、减少人工核对负担的长远之道。

       实践案例:销售数据月度核对

       假设财务部有一份系统导出的月度销售总表,而业务部也手工维护了一份。两者需核对金额。步骤可以是:1. 统一两表的日期、客户编号、产品编号格式。2. 使用Power Query将两表导入,以“日期+客户+产品”为键进行“完全外部合并”,找出仅存在于一方的记录。3. 对于两方都存在的记录,新增一列计算“财务金额”减“业务金额”,筛选出差值不为0的行。4. 将差异清单导出,交由双方确认源头单据,修正错误数据。这个过程系统化地解决了不同excel如何核对的难题。

       

       总而言之,核对不同Excel文件并非一项单一任务,而是一个从目标分析、方法选择、工具执行到结果处理的完整闭环。从简单的手工操作到复杂的公式与专业工具,每一种方法都有其适用的场景。掌握这些方法,并根据实际情况灵活运用或组合,您就能从容应对各类数据核对挑战,确保手中数据的准确与可靠,为决策提供坚实的数据基础。希望本文为您系统梳理的思路与方案,能成为您处理类似工作时的一份实用指南。

推荐文章
相关文章
推荐URL
在Excel中创建甘道图(Gantt Chart),即项目进度图,核心方法是利用堆积条形图来可视化任务的开始时间、持续时长与进度关系,并通过调整数据系列格式、设置坐标轴等步骤实现专业呈现。本文将系统解析从数据准备、图表构建到美化的全流程,助您高效掌握这一实用项目管理工具。
2026-03-15 15:27:30
312人看过
当用户提出“excel如何不去整”时,其核心需求是希望在处理Excel数据时,避免因自动格式化、四舍五入、数据类型误判等常见问题导致数据被擅自“整理”或“改动”,从而保持数据的原始精确性和完整性。本文将系统性地解释这一需求背后的多种场景,并提供从设置调整到函数应用等一系列详实可靠的解决方案。
2026-03-15 12:43:35
234人看过
当用户询问“excel如何横换竖”时,其核心需求通常是将数据从横向排列转换为纵向排列,或反之,这可以通过多种内置功能实现,例如选择性粘贴中的转置功能、使用公式或借助透视表等工具来完成,掌握这些方法能极大提升数据处理效率。
2026-03-15 12:43:26
57人看过
在Excel中进行排序,核心是通过选择目标数据区域,在“数据”选项卡中使用“排序”功能,依据数值、文本、日期或自定义序列等关键字段,设定升序或降序规则,即可快速整理信息。掌握如何做Excel排序,能显著提升数据处理的效率与准确性。
2026-03-15 12:42:05
90人看过
热门推荐
热门专题:
资讯中心: